2.9.4.2 The breech<strong>in</strong>g <strong>in</strong>lets shall be located with<strong>in</strong> 18m from the fire<br />
eng<strong>in</strong>e accessway and be visible from the fire eng<strong>in</strong>e<br />
accessway. Breech<strong>in</strong>g <strong>in</strong>lets shall be appropriately numbered<br />
and labelled as shown <strong>in</strong> Diagram 2.9.4.2.<br />
2.9.4.3 Two standby hoses shall be provided at each of the follow<strong>in</strong>g<br />
locations:<br />
(a) Buffer area with<strong>in</strong> 3m from the stair lead<strong>in</strong>g to the<br />
tra<strong>in</strong>ways (see Diagram 2.9.4.3(a));<br />
(b) Mid tunnel exit staircase; and<br />
(c) Underground or enclosed tra<strong>in</strong>way portal (see Diagram<br />
2.9.4.3(c)).<br />
Standby hoses shall be provided <strong>in</strong> accordance with<br />
APPENDIX F with the exception of Cl. F2.1.<br />
2.9.4.4 Automatic fire detection systems shall be provided at designated<br />
locations <strong>in</strong> underground or enclosed tra<strong>in</strong>ways where tra<strong>in</strong>s are<br />
stabled dur<strong>in</strong>g non-revenue hours. The guidance <strong>for</strong> selection of<br />
detectors is described <strong>in</strong> SS CP 10. The use of l<strong>in</strong>e type heat<br />
detectors is permissible.<br />
2.9.5 COMMUNICATION<br />
2.9.5.1 Underground or enclosed tra<strong>in</strong>ways shall be provided with<br />
radio communication facilities capable of operat<strong>in</strong>g <strong>in</strong> the<br />
frequency band of 470 - 490 MHz range.<br />
2.9.5.2 <strong>Fire</strong> resistant cables comply<strong>in</strong>g with SS 299 shall be used <strong>for</strong><br />
communication system equipment specified <strong>in</strong> this standard,<br />
except <strong>for</strong> the leaky co-axial (LCX) cables which are required<br />
to be fire retardant.<br />
2.9.6<br />
EMERGENCY VENTILATION SYSTEM<br />
2.9.6.1 A mechanical emergency ventilation shall be provided <strong>in</strong><br />
underground or enclosed tra<strong>in</strong>ways exceed<strong>in</strong>g 300m.<br />
2.9.6.2 A mechanical emergency ventilation system is not required <strong>for</strong><br />
underground or enclosed tra<strong>in</strong>ways not exceed<strong>in</strong>g 60m <strong>in</strong><br />
length.<br />
